matRad - a multi-modality open source 3D treatment planning toolkit

We present matRad, an open source software for three-dimensional radiation treatment planning of intensitymodulated photon, proton, and carbon ion therapy. matRad is developed for educational and research purposes; it is entirely written in MATLAB. A first beta release is available for download. The toolkit features a highly modular design with a set of individual functions modeling the entire treatment planning workflow based on a segmented patient CT. All algorithms, e.g. for ray tracing, photon/proton/carbon dose calculation, fluence optimization, and multileaf collimator sequencing, follow well-established approaches and operate on clinically adequate voxel and bixel resolution. Patient data as well as base data for all required computations is included in matRad. We achieve computation times of 60-100s (60-400s) for realistic patient cases including photon (particle) dose calculation and fluence optimization. Memory consumption ranges between 0.2GB and 2.2GB. Dose distributions of a treatment planning study for a phantom and prostate patient case considering multiple radiation modalities are shown. Both the computational and dosimetric results encourage a future use of matRad in an educational and scientific setting.

[1]  P. Xia,et al.  Multileaf collimator leaf sequencing algorithm for intensity modulated beams with multiple static segments. , 1998, Medical physics.

[2]  R. Siddon Fast calculation of the exact radiological path for a three-dimensional CT array. , 1985, Medical physics.

[3]  Y. X. Wang,et al.  Nuclear Instruments and Methods in Physics Research Section B : Beam Interactions with Materials and Atoms , 2018 .

[4]  Dávid Papp,et al.  Shared data for intensity modulated radiation therapy (IMRT) optimization research: the CORT dataset , 2014, GigaScience.

[5]  Robert J. Schneider,et al.  Multiple Coulomb scattering of 160 MeV protons , 1993 .

[6]  T. Bortfeld,et al.  Decomposition of pencil beam kernels for fast dose calculations in three-dimensional treatment planning. , 1993, Medical physics.

[7]  T Bortfeld,et al.  An analytical approximation of the Bragg curve for therapeutic proton beams. , 1997, Medical physics.

[8]  D Sánchez-Parcerisa,et al.  FoCa: a modular treatment planning system for proton radiotherapy with research and educational purposes , 2014, Physics in medicine and biology.

[9]  T. Bortfeld,et al.  Inverse planning for photon and proton beams. , 2001, Medical dosimetry : official journal of the American Association of Medical Dosimetrists.

[10]  Uwe Oelfke,et al.  A 3D isodose manipulation tool for interactive dose shaping , 2014 .

[11]  Simeon Nill Development and application of a multi-modality inverse treatment planning system , 2001 .

[12]  M Goitein,et al.  A pencil beam algorithm for proton dose calculations. , 1996, Physics in medicine and biology.

[13]  Philipp Hennig,et al.  Analytical probabilistic modeling for radiation therapy treatment planning , 2013, Physics in medicine and biology.

[14]  Joseph O Deasy,et al.  CERR: a computational environment for radiotherapy research. , 2003, Medical physics.

[15]  O Jäkel,et al.  Treatment planning for heavy-ion radiotherapy: physical beam model and dose optimization. , 2000, Physics in medicine and biology.

[16]  J. Mechalakos,et al.  IMRT commissioning: multiple institution planning and dosimetry comparisons, a report from AAPM Task Group 119. , 2009, Medical physics.